PostSubject: Honor upheld, a trip to Goodbay   Sat Aug 22, 2009 11:38 pm

Lohtar Tanneman walks in silent respect to the gate of Goodbay, helmet off and weapon sheathed. He carries a large bag over his shoulder, when approaching the two guards at the gate the bag gently swings out and is placed upon the ground with what some might call reverence. Hearing the muffled sound of metal clanking, the guards turn to him with a curious eye. He remains holding his calm demeanor and bows slightly, “Gentlemen… I am returning the belongings of your fallen brothers in arms.”
The younger of the two begins to draw his blade and is quickly met with a frown from the elder of the guards, waving his actions off quickly. The elder guard steps forward, eyeing what can be seen of the large bag of armaments this man has just returned to their city. “What is the meaning of this stranger? Why is it you walk into this fair city with the belongings of Solamnic Knights?” His hand reflexively moves to the pommel of his own sword and rests there.
Lohtar, remaining relaxed, his arms at his side, states plainly, “Your comrades wanted to arrest and question me sir knight, I simply could not comply. The knights stated that if I did not go quietly then they would cut me down. This not being something I was readily agreeable to, we drew our weapons and fought in honorable combat. These men fought with great honor and should continue to be honored by your people for many years to come. I am simply here returning their belongings to the rightful family or to the knighthood, however your commander should see fit.”
The knights both shuffle uncomfortably, both of them now with their hand on the pommel of their swords. “You realize we should strike you down right here for your atrocities”, said the younger knight.
“No, considering his actions, it would not be honorable for us to do so. Though I do want to know, what did you do with the bodies of the fallen? I pray to Paladine you didn’t leave them to rot on the road”, said the other from under his flowing moustaches.
I did no such thing gentlemen”, replied Lohtar calmly. I built each of them an individual cairn so animals and carrion birds did not pick at them. For each I gave a warrior’s blessing and praised my goddess to watch over your honorable comrades. They rest in peace at a location disclosed in these documents.” He hands over a scroll sealed with the symbol of a five-headed dragon. “Give this to your commander; it is detailed information that can be used to find the gravesite of your knights as well as a map further denoting the location.” Each of the knights nod slightly, visibly showing surprise that this man is so incredibly calm, given what he is doing.
“Very well then,” stated the elder knight through clenched teeth, the commander shall be informed immediately.
“See that he does, good day to you gentlemen, pray to the queen our paths do not cross again.” Lohtar then spins on a heel and strides away confidently, his head held high. He listens for movement behind him and hears none, then mutters to himself when out of earshot, “This will not be the last time your knights’ possessions are returned, praise be to Takhisis.” He looks back only once to see the younger of the knights head off to deliver the message.
